I am evaluating the possibility to extend the PolyhedralSurface geometry type in postgraph, in order to store BIM (building Information modeling) graph. But source code make failed by undeclared variables in cypher_analyze.c, The erros are "parse_hook,parse_analyze_hook,create_command_tag_hook" being undeclared variables in cypher_analyze.c.I also can't find above three variables in postgres headers. So this project is undergoing a lot of changes right now and its not in the most usable condition, sorry about that.

This version of PostGraph is using a modified version of Postgres. The thesis being that with a feel small additions to Postgres, you can add a new query language. *EDIT: and storage engine

You can find the modified version of Postgres here. https://github.com/PostGraphDB/postgres_for_postgraph

I also made a branch from the project before I added these new hooks, https://github.com/PostGraphDB/postgraph/tree/old_main. You can take a look while I get the main branch to a workable state
